Leonardo da Vinci ’s masterpieces, from the Mona Lisa to the Vitruvian Man , are frequently reimagined in commercial photography and advertising to evoke feelings of timelessness, genius, and luxury. While his original 15th-century works are in the , modern commercial use often involves either licensing high-quality museum reproductions or creating original "da Vinci-style" photography that mimics his signature lighting and anatomical precision.
